Understanding Plant Propagation
Propagation is a method of producing new plants from a variety of sources: seeds, cuttings, or other plant parts. The goal is to clone a plant with the desirable traits of the parent. The two main methods of propagation we'll discuss today are seed propagation and cutting propagation.
Seed Propagation
Seed propagation involves growing plants from seeds. This method is often used for various vegetables, ornamentals, and trees. However, one must be cautious—plants grown from seeds may not always "come true" to the parent plant in appearance or quality. This variability can make seed propagation a bit of a gamble.
Cutting Propagation
Cutting propagation involves rooting a piece of a parent plant to produce a clone. This method is popular for many houseplants, perennials, and some fruit-bearing shrubs because it is a reliable way to get genetically identical plants.
The Sand Propagation Method: A Popular Choice
One question we frequently receive is about the sand propagation method. This technique is beloved for its simplicity and effectiveness with certain types of plants—but is it right for every plant?
What is Sand Propagation?
In sand propagation, a cutting is inserted into a sand medium to encourage root development. The well-draining properties of sand help maintain moisture levels while providing enough aeration for root growth. This method is particularly useful for species that root readily from cuttings, like figs, goji berries, elderberries, pomegranates, and mulberries.
Can You Use Sand Propagation for All Plants?
Despite its popularity, the sand propagation method is not a one-size-fits-all solution. Can you root an apple cutting in the sand propagation method? Can you root citrus trees this way? The answer, most likely, is no.
Here's why:
Apples and Citrus Trees: Generally, these trees are not propagated by rooting cuttings. They are typically grafted onto seedling rootstock because they do not readily root.
Pears and Cherries: Similar to apples and citrus, these require grafting. While it's theoretically possible to root them, it's exceptionally challenging, and success rates are low.
Grafting: The Go-To for Non-Rooting Cuttings
Grafting involves attaching a cutting, or scion, onto a prepared part of a plant, or rootstock. This method is preferred for certain fruit trees and offers several advantages—ensuring consistency in fruit quality, disease resistance, and sometimes dwarfism for easier harvest.

The Genetics Behind Seed Propagation
While I’m a fan of growing plants from seed, it's essential to understand the genetic variability inherent to this method. Some fruits, like apples, have extensive genetic diversity. This means a seed from a tasty apple might grow into a tree that produces less than palatable fruit.
Why Genetic Diversity Matters
When considering seed propagation, know that:
Trees like apples and citrus may not replicate the parent plant.
Good Potential Fruits: Some seed-grown fruits, like pawpaws, may turn out well even from seedlings due to less genetic variability.
To sum it up: when growing trees from seed, you're rolling the dice on the characteristics of the resulting plant.
